‘The View’ Goes Dark After White House Demand

Reports from the world of daytime television indicate that the long-running talk show “The View” is preparing for its customary summer hiatus. This development comes amid a series of statements and controversies surrounding the program and its hosts.

During Thursday’s broadcast, host Joy Behar inadvertently disclosed the impending break, prompting a brief exchange with the show’s executive producer. Co-host Whoopi Goldberg later clarified that the program would return for a new season in September, aligning with standard practices in broadcast television.

The announcement follows criticism from the White House in response to comments made by Behar regarding former President Trump and former President Obama. A White House spokesperson issued a statement questioning the show’s relevance and citing reported low ratings.

To understand this fully, we should note that “The View” typically observes a summer hiatus, often concluding its season in late July or early August before resuming in September. Sources familiar with the matter confirm that this break is part of the show’s established schedule.
